Player Prop Week 18

Las Vegas Raiders vs Denver Broncos

 
 
 
Davante Adams Receptions Prop is currently Over/Under 6.5 (+115/-145).

The money has been on the Over as it opened 5.5 @ -150 before it was bet up to 6.5 @ +115.
F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E OVER:
  • The passing offenses of both teams (in terms of both volume and efficiency) figure to benefit from the still "weather" conditions (as in zero wind) inside this dome, while ground volume may go down.
  • The predictive model expects Davante Adams to total 11.4 targets in this week's contest, on balance, putting him in the 98th percentile when it comes to wideouts.
  • Davante Adams's 86.5 WOPR (Weighted Opportunity Rating—an advanced stat that quantifies high-value offensive usage) has been significantly higher this season than it was last season at 75.0.
  • As it relates to protecting the passer (and the strong impact it has on all pass attack stats), the O-line of the Raiders ranks as the 7th-best in the league this year.
  • Davante Adams has been one of the best WRs in the game this year, averaging a stellar 6.0 adjusted receptions per game while checking in at the 93rd percentile.

  • F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E UNDER:
  • With a 3-point advantage, the Raiders are favored in this week's game, indicating more of a focus on rushing than their standard approach.
  • Right now, the 8th-least pass-heavy offense in the NFL (58.0% in a neutral context) according to the model is the Las Vegas Raiders.
  • The predictive model expects the Raiders to call the 8th-fewest total plays on the slate this week with 63.5 plays, given their underlying play style and game dynamics.
  • The 2nd-fewest plays in football have been run by the Raiders this year (just 54.5 per game on average).
  • Davante Adams is positioned as one of the most hard-handed receivers in football, hauling in a mere 59.1% of passes thrown his way (adjusted for context) this year, checking in at the 21st percentile among wideouts
